BAT OUT OF HELL Extends Through To January 2019
by Stephi Wild
- Jul 26, 2018
Jim Steinman's Bat Out Of Hell - The Musical will be extending into 2019, with a new booking period at the Dominion Theatre from 27 October 2018 to 5 January 2019 going on sale at 12.00noon today, Thursday 26 July 2918. The winner of the Evening Standard Radio 2 Audience Award for Best Musical 2017 began previews at the Dominion Theatre on Monday 2 April, with a gala performance on 19 April 2018.

Booking Extension Announced For BAT OUT OF HELL At Dominion
by Stephi Wild
- Apr 4, 2018
In celebration of the official opening night of Jim Steinman's Bat Out Of Hell - The Musical at the Dominion Theatre on Thursday 19 April 2018, and due to overwhelming demand for tickets, the producers have announced a new booking period from 30 July to 27 October 2018, with tickets going on sale at 10.00am on 19 April. The winner of the Evening Standard Radio 2 Audience Award for Best Musical 2017 began previews on Monday 2 April.
